Commercial Posting for Career Vacancies in Biomedical Research Products

Life Science Resources is an established, fast growing, high-tech company
involved in world-wide sales of computer-based imaging products for life
sciences and medicine. We offer systems ranging from real time, low light
level ion imaging systems to molecular biology imaging systems for FISH
applications. We have also recently acquired AstroCam, a leading
manufacturer of high performance digital CCD camera systems. We offer our
products through dealers and distributors worldwide, and we have offices
both in Cambridge, England and the USA on the East Coast.

We have openings for the following exciting positions:

Biomedical Imaging Applications Support Engineers
are required for pre- and post-sales support, including installation and
training for  systems in customer laboratories. Experience at post-graduate
level of optical probe applications in life sciences is essential, including
competence in computing and image processing techniques. This position may
involve both national and foreign travel and could provide the opportunity
to work from the company's USA office or from their offices in England.

Software Engineers for Biomedical Applications
Applications programmers are required for development of real time data
acquisition systems (particularly imaging) under Windows 95.  The job will
involve integration of new technology hardware and software components into
the company's range of biomedical research instruments.  Visual C/C++ and
MFC experience essential, and a grounding in biology/biotechnology would be
extremely useful.
